About the Role: A welder will perform a variety of fabrication duties to assist with the production of Pole Transformers.
Duties/Responsibilities:
• Responsible for assembling pieces of metal together or repairing damage in metal
• Performs a variety of duties including, but not limited to production needs, fabrication and welding
• Able to read and follow blueprints
• Able to cut metal into appropriate shape and size
• Able to smooth molten metal to remove creases
• Able to weld with all different types of metal, including steel and aluminum
• Complies with safety guidelines and procedures
• Produces and maintains accurate records
• Performs other duties as assigned
